The Dueso Penal is an old and legendary prison and penitentiary colony in Spain, still in operation, located by the sea, in the eponymous neighborhood of the city of Santoña, formerly in the province of Santander, and today in the Community of Cantabria. It was inaugurated in 1907, making use of the buildings of the barracks and the Dueso Square that already existed, and in the face of the opposition from the Catalans to the transfer of prisoners from Africa to the prison of Figueres.
